EmbarkStudios / spirtLinks
SPIR-๐น: shader-focused IR to target, transform and translate from ๐ฆ
โ102Updated last year
Alternatives and similar repositories for spirt
Users that are interested in spirt are comparing it to the libraries listed below
Sorting:
- Vulkan-lite GPU APIโ89Updated last year
- Implementation agnostic memory allocator for Vulkan-like APIsโ88Updated last year
- A crate to help you copy things into raw buffers without invoking spooky action at a distance (undefined behavior).โ159Updated last year
- Rust crate to generate GLSL structs with explicitly-initialized padding bytesโ73Updated 6 months ago
- A low-level gltf parser implemented on nanoserdeโ35Updated 10 months ago
- ๐ Wrapper crate for SPIRV-Tools ๐ฆโ28Updated last year
- Rust EDSL for shading languagesโ90Updated 3 years ago
- Physically based rendering in Rustโ37Updated last year
- Rust Graphics meetupsโ68Updated 3 years ago
- High performance, low level 2D path rasterization library in pure Rust.โ115Updated 3 months ago
- shadertoy.com shaders ported to Rust-GPUโ154Updated last week
- Task Orchestration Frameworkโ57Updated last year
- high-quality anti-aliased vector graphics rendering on the GPUโ87Updated 2 years ago
- Simple profiler scopes for wgpu using timer queriesโ114Updated last month
- โ138Updated 7 months ago
- Fast polygon mesh library with different data structures and traits to abstract over those.โ81Updated 8 months ago
- Reflection API in rust for SPIR-V shader byte code, intended for Vulkan applicationsโ109Updated 7 months ago
- Provides a mechanism to lay out data into GPU buffers according to WGSL's memory layout rulesโ181Updated 2 months ago
- Library for post-process antialiasingโ105Updated 3 months ago
- Just use daxa. Rust support is in active development, as I am a maintainer of the Rust API! https://github.com/ipotrick/daxa https://githโฆโ100Updated last year
- ๐ Superluminal Performance profiler Rust API ๐ฆโ101Updated 3 months ago
- ๐ Statically linked MoltenVK for Vulkan on Mac using Ash ๐ฆโ103Updated 11 months ago
- Tight Model format is an experimental lossy 3D model format focused on reducing file size as much as posible without decreasing visual quโฆโ109Updated last year
- Color in Rust.โ87Updated 2 weeks ago
- Generate typesafe Rust bindings from WGSL shaders to wgpuโ50Updated 3 weeks ago
- GPU driven real-time renderer, backed by wgpu and rust-gpuโ169Updated last week
- A safe Rust FFI binding for the NVIDIAยฎ Tools Extension SDK (NVTX).โ86Updated last year
- Light weight SPIR-V reflection libraryโ111Updated 8 months ago
- RenderDoc application bindings for Rustโ50Updated last year
- BVH Construction and Traversal Libraryโ65Updated 3 weeks ago